The Real Cost Components of a 2kW Solar-Storage System
Let's break down the typical investment for a fully functional 2kW-class hybrid system in the U.S. or European market. Prices vary by region, installer, and component quality.
| Component | Description | Estimated Cost Range (USD/EUR) |
|---|---|---|
| Hybrid Inverter (e.g., InfiniSolar 2kW) | The brain of the system, converting DC to AC and managing energy flow. | $1,000 - $1,800 |
| Solar Panels (2-2.5 kW array) | High-efficiency monocrystalline panels to capture sunlight. | $1,500 - $2,500 |
| Battery Storage (5-10 kWh) | Lithium-ion battery bank to store excess energy for use at night or during outages. | $3,000 - $6,000+ |
| Balance of System (BOS) | Wiring, mounting, safety disconnects, monitoring hardware. | $500 - $1,200 |
| Professional Installation & Permits | Labor, grid connection fees, local permits, and inspections. | $1,500 - $3,000 |
| Total Estimated System Cost | $7,500 - $14,500+ |
Remember, this is a system. Choosing components that are not designed to work seamlessly together can lead to inefficiency, reduced lifespan, and even safety risks. A Real-World Case: The Johnson Household in Texas
Let's look at real data. The Johnson family in Austin, Texas, installed a 2.4kW solar array with a 5kWh lithium battery and a hybrid inverter in Q2 2022. Their primary goals were to backup essential loads during frequent grid disturbances and offset rising utility costs.
- Upfront System Cost: $11,200 (after applying the 26% federal Investment Tax Credit available at the time).
- Annual Savings: Their electricity bill decreased by an average of $85/month, or ~$1,020 annually.
- ROI & Payback: The system provides an estimated return on investment (ROI) of ~9% per year, with a simple payback period of about 11 years on the net cost. Crucially, it has provided over 150 hours of uninterrupted backup power during grid outages, protecting their home office and refrigerator.
This case shows the financial mechanics: the cost is an upfront capital investment that generates monthly savings and invaluable resilience. For current incentives, always check authoritative sources like the U.S. Department of Energy or the European Commission's energy policies.
Why the "System" Matters More Than the Inverter Brand
While a reliable inverter is crucial, its performance is dictated by the ecosystem it operates in. A premium inverter paired with low-quality batteries or poor installation will underperform. Key considerations include:
- Battery Compatibility & Longevity: Will the inverter's communication protocol optimally charge and protect your specific battery chemistry?
- Scalability: Can you easily add more panels or battery capacity later if your needs change?
- Grid Interaction & Software Intelligence: Can the system intelligently decide when to draw from the grid, use solar, or discharge batteries based on time-of-use rates to maximize savings?

Making Your Decision: Key Questions to Ask
So, when evaluating "how much" a system will cost, arm yourself with these questions for any potential provider:
- Is this quote for a single component or a complete, installed system?
- How does your system's software actively manage energy to improve my financial return, beyond just basic self-consumption?
- What is the expected cycle life of the battery system, and what is the guaranteed end-of-life capacity?
- Can you provide a detailed performance and savings projection based on my historical energy data?
